Output 8cccaa2df99425aca23c8e7fdf4b2c17fbd7f1c5a99b8bff1a2093579b3ce0d2:2

value
3190390
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bba7c4ce64f1ae696bdf2522b87a9122092dcec OP_EQUALVERIFY OP_CHECKSIG
address
13XceRWDqS8WvxnpHQzi8SVZAtcXMKaEjo
transaction
8cccaa2df99425aca23c8e7fdf4b2c17fbd7f1c5a99b8bff1a2093579b3ce0d2
confirmations
170505
spent
true